site stats

Grpc http2 protobuf

WebNov 8, 2024 · GRPC is the tool that combines actually two things: extended Protobuf (Service support) and HTTP2. I read a lot of articles saying that using GRPC is awesome … WebgRPC is a modern open source high performance Remote Procedure Call (RPC) framework that can run in any environment. It can efficiently connect services in and across data … Metadata. Metadata is information about a particular RPC call (such as … Dear gRPC users, We, the gRPC maintainers, are trying to better … gRPC tools. Python’s gRPC tools include the protocol buffer compiler protoc and … Then, once you’ve specified your data structures, you use the protocol buffer … gRPC is a modern open source high performance Remote Procedure Call … Road to gRPC by Junho Choi et al., Cloudflare. October 26, 2024. How … Running gRPC and Protobuf on ARM64 (on Linux) Wednesday, June 23, 2024 in … The gRPC Ecosystem is a GitHub organization that hosts community … A high-performance, open source universal RPC framework

opentelemetry-specification/otlp.md at main · open-telemetry ... - GitHub

WebApr 12, 2024 · Protobuf文档生成; Protobuf项目格式、规范 项目格式. 先介绍一下Protobuf的项目格式、规范。所有的Protobuf文件都应该存在在一个统一的仓库、仓库 … WebSep 21, 2024 · gRPC is designed for HTTP/2, a major revision of HTTP that provides significant performance benefits over HTTP 1.x: Binary framing and compression. … bronchoskopie lokalanästhesie https://naked-bikes.com

REST vs. gRPC. Which one is faster “gRPC - Medium

WebGoogle released gRPC, a cross-platform RPC stack over HTTP/2 using protobuf serialization included in the Google bits is Grpc.Core, Google's gRPC bindings for .NET; it has kinks: the "protoc" codegen tool only offers C# (for .NET) and is proto3 only contract-first only the actual HTTP/2 bits are in an unmanaged binary WebFeb 3, 2024 · Wireshark is an open source network protocol analyzer that can be used for protocol development, network troubleshooting, and education. Wireshark lets you … WebMar 18, 2011 · Protobuf는 서버와 클라이언트에서 매우 빠르게 직렬화합니다. Protobuf serialization은 작은 메시지 페이로드를 발생시키며 이는 모바일 앱과 같은 제한된 대역폭 … bronja perlmutter

gRPC vs Message Broker Memphis{dev}

Category:Golang with protobuf & GRPC/HTTP2 by Prateek Gupta Nerd …

Tags:Grpc http2 protobuf

Grpc http2 protobuf

Maven Repository: io.grpc » grpc-protobuf-lite » 1.50.3

WebAug 20, 2024 · HTTP/2 provides a foundation for long-lived, real-time communication streams. gRPC builds on top of this foundation with connection pooling, health … WebJan 7, 2024 · Since HTTP/2 relies on the transferred data being binary encoded protobuf plays a very important role for gRPC. gRPC supports code-generation for many of the …

Grpc http2 protobuf

Did you know?

WebMar 8, 2024 · gRPC service definitions are here. Protobuf definitions for requests and responses are here. Please make sure to check the proto version and maturity level . Schemas for different signals may be at different maturity level - some stable, some in beta. OTLP/gRPC Default Port The default network port for OTLP/gRPC is 4317. OTLP/HTTP WebgRPC: Protobuf Lite License: Apache 2.0: Tags: grpc protobuf ... gRPC Contributors: grpc-iogooglegroups.com: grpc.io: gRPC Authors ... aws build build-system client …

WebgRPC is a modern open source high performance Remote Procedure Call (RPC) framework that can run in any environment. It can efficiently connect services in and across data centers with pluggable support for load … WebFeb 21, 2024 · В этой реализации у нас есть клиент в виде браузера и есть прокси — Envoy, которое фактически преобразует запросы из HTTP/1.1 в HTTP/2.0. При этом мы получаем бинарные сообщения протокола protobuf.

WebApr 12, 2024 · Protobuf文档生成; Protobuf项目格式、规范 项目格式. 先介绍一下Protobuf的项目格式、规范。所有的Protobuf文件都应该存在在一个统一的仓库、仓库组中,至于具体的存储方案可以看团队的大小,小团队可以无脑使用单仓库存放。 WebFeb 21, 2024 · В этой реализации у нас есть клиент в виде браузера и есть прокси — Envoy, которое фактически преобразует запросы из HTTP/1.1 в HTTP/2.0. При этом …

WebJan 31, 2024 · Select the Grpc.Net.Client package from the Browse tab and select Install. Repeat for Google.Protobuf and Grpc.Tools. Add greet.proto Create a Protos folder in the gRPC client project. Copy the Protos\greet.proto file from the gRPC Greeter service to the Protos folder in the gRPC client project.

WebApr 13, 2024 · 下载通用编译器 下载地址: v3.20.1 · Releases · protocolbuffers/protobuf · GitHub 根据不同的操作系统,下载不同的包,我是windows电脑,解压出来是 protoc.exe 配置环境变量 解压后会在bin目录下有一个protoc.exe 在path中配置 安装go专用的protoc的生成器 go1.18之后使用如下命令 go install github.com/golang/protobuf/protoc-gen … brona henna kitWebJul 3, 2024 · gRPC is not faster than REST over HTTP/2 by default, but it gives you the tools to make it faster. There are some things that would be difficult or impossible to do with … bronkallaWeb2 days ago · Dubbo 在 2.7.5 版本开始支持原生 gRPC 协议,对于计划使用 HTTP/2 通信或者期望 gRPC 协议支持服务治理能力的,都可以考虑接入 Dubbo 体系启用 gRPC 协议 … bronchi suomeksiWebApr 14, 2024 · grpc_server.go是服务端代码,用来提供服务,以便客户端来连接,访问对应的服务 创建product.proto // 这个就是protobuf的中间文件 // 指定的当前proto语法的版本,有2和3 syntax = "proto3"; option go_package= "../service"; // 指定等会文件生成出来的package package service; // 定义request model message ProductRequest { int32 prod_id = 1; // 1 … bronkiitin hoitoWebMay 18, 2024 · Protocol Buffer (aka Protobuf) was developed by Google and publicly released in 2008. Protobuf is an Interface Definition Language that is language-neutral … bronchosan husten akutWebgRPC: Protobuf License: Apache 2.0: Categories: Object Serialization: Tags: format grpc protobuf serialization rpc protocol: ... aws build build-system client clojure cloud config cran data database eclipse example extension github gradle groovy http io jboss kotlin library logging maven module npm persistence platform plugin rest rlang sdk ... bronkiitti lapsellaWebSep 5, 2024 · gRPC is the framework that is used to implement APIs using HTTP/2 Basically, gRPC uses the protobuf for serialization and HTTP2 protocol which provides lots more advantages than HTTP gRPC clients and servers intercommunicate utilizing a variety of environments and machines, It Also supports many languages like Java, C#, Go, … bronkiitti hoito